Adding Shopify to your Squarespace website is a simple process that can be completed in just a few steps. First, you’ll need to create a Shopify account and then connect it to your Squarespace site. Once you’ve done that, you can start adding products and creating collections.
Shopify is a powerful ecommerce platform that gives you everything you need to sell online. It’s easy to use, has a wide range of features, and integrates seamlessly with Squarespace. Adding Shopify to your Squarespace website is the best way to start selling online.
Here’s how to do it:
1. Create a Shopify account
The first step is to create a Shopify account. You can do this by visiting Shopify.com and clicking the “Create your store” button. Enter your email address, create a password, and then click the “Create your store” button again.
2. Connect Shopify to Squarespace
Once you’ve created your Shopify account, you’ll need to connect it to your Squarespace website. This can be done by going to the Shopify app store and installing the Squarespace Ecommerce App. Once you’ve installed the app, you’ll need to enter your Squarespace login credentials (your email address and password) and then click the “Connect” button.

3. Start adding products
Now that Shopify is connected to your Squarespace website, you can start adding products. To do this, click on the “Products” tab in your Shopify dashboard and then click on the “Add product” button.
Enter a name for your product, select a product type, and then add an image and description. Once you’re done, click on the “Save” button.
4. Create collections
Collections are groups of products that you can use to organize your store. To create a collection, click on the “Collections” tab in your Shopify dashboard and then click on the “Add collection” button. Enter a name for your collection and then select the products that you want to add to it.
Once you’re done, click on the “Save” button. And that’s it! You’ve successfully added Shopify to your Squarespace website!
